Left Amazon at L6 ten months ago. Someone on a team there reached out this week about an L7 role. Is it even possible to loop for it? I’ve searched past threads and it seems like “maybe.” How much influence will my former manager have? I left with a “HV+” rating, and for a position with a higher title than my former manager’s, who...made some snarky remarks to me about it when he found out. Generally what’s the boomerang process?
Boomerang within 6 months, you dont need an interview and you can only come back in the same level. 6months to 1 year, if coming back to same level, the HM can opt to skip the interview. If coming back for a level up after 6months then interview is a must. They will review your past ratings...

How do stocks work as boomerang and can you get new vests if you leave after 4 year initial vest and financially speaking is it in your best interest to earn stock this way?
You will get new vests with a new 4 year cycle. You might end up getting more for year 3 and 4, but most probably take a loss for years 1 and 2. But the expectation is that had you continued to stay, you would have leveled up or reach TT rating by the time you hit the 3 year mark.
They will want to make an example of you. Very unlikely you will be rehired at L7, because they don’t want the team to think they can boomerang and level up. They’ll say you haven’t been away long enough to demonstrate L7 examples at the new place. Happened to me.
